BrickyOdin Posted August 9, 2016 Share Posted August 9, 2016 To update today I contacted tattoo parlor with pics they say it's bad razor burn. And in all fairness the redness has eased up today. And the swelling has decreased. Thanks for replies guys. I was worried about cellulitis but apart from redness there was no other symptoms which would include heat, itchiness, pus, spreading redness etc. Swelling is quite normal apparently. Think I just have very sensitive skin lol. Dan Posted January 16, 2017 Share Posted January 16, 2017 6 hours ago, Evie P said: So glad to have found this forum, after getting lower leg tattooed and experiencing swelling. All very much the same as you guys, but just wondering how long swelling lasts (got mine done 6 days ago) and am due to get the remainder on my foot in 2 weeks time. First time i have ever experienced swelling but all other tattoos are on my back, arm and shoulder. it varies,it's different for all of us,also depends on how much you are on your feet standing/walking, you can try an anti-inflammatory like Aleve or some form of Naproxen, and maybe try ice packing it, and sit down more and elevate your leg,treat it like any other injury to your leg, length of swelling ? my hands swelled after the tattoo for just a few days.but like I said it will vary from person to person.
